The Chateau d’Angers, a medieval castle overlooking the Loire River, is open to the public and contains a 14th century woven tapestry that is over 100 meters long. The tapestry depicts 70 apocalyptic scenes from the Book of Revelations. The castle is open for tours and is illuminated at night, making for a spectacular vista. The seat of power for the Duke of Anjou, the Chateau is an imposing structure whose long shadows would have loomed large in the lives of the Jewish community of Angers
